5 Ideas for One-Approach Masking in Colleges


Advice for efficient one-approach masking from Linsey Marr, a number one skilled on airborne viruses


Mask mandates usually are not returning in most faculty districts in the midst of the latest COVID surge. Solely 2 p.c of the nation’s 500 largest school districts require masks (opens in new tab) based on Burbio, an information service that has been tracking faculty policies all through the pandemic. That is although circumstances have recently elevated (opens in new tab) by 26 % and on average 3,000 Individuals are being hospitalized per day and 275 people are dying.


However, teachers still looking for to keep away from publicity to COVID can one-manner mask, which can nonetheless scale back threat, say specialists (opens in new tab). Linsey Marr, a professor of civil and environmental engineering at Virginia Tech and a leading authority on airborne viruses, says there are greatest practices to remember for one-method masking.


1. High quality of Mask Issues for One-Means Masking


One-method masking might be highly efficient with the correct mask. As most are conscious, N95s are the favored mask (opens in new tab) due to the excessive-quality and tight match, however KN95s and KF94s can present comparable levels of safety, although there are numerous pretend KN95s on the market to be cautious of, Marr says. In research performed at Marr’s lab and another lab (opens in new tab), these masks supplied about 90 p.c safety towards particles within the air. Whereas still better than no mask, cloth masks are not as effective, Marr says.


“If you have not tried one of those so-known as respirators, such as an N95, KN95, or KF94, you might want to give it a try because you can get quite a bit better safety,” she says. “They are, usually, really easier to breathe via and simpler to speak in compared to a cloth mask.”


2. Remember that Without Common Masking There is no such thing as a Supply Management


If everyone in a school is sporting a mask that provides what consultants name supply management. “If someone is infected, the mask blocks their viruses from entering into the air. So that helps scale back viruses within the air that everybody's breathing,” Marr says. “If you're simply counting on one-layer masking, you might have contaminated people who are releasing the virus into the air, so there might be extra within the air. However if you're carrying a very good-high quality mask, you will ideally breathe in very little of it.”


3. Match Is Important When One-Method Masking


“You're on the lookout for a tight seal all the way round, so no gaps,” Marr says. “This can occur, particularly around the nostril bridge. So you positively need a mask that has a wire, some sort of bendable metal that you can shape round your nostril. Be careful for gaps on the sides of the cheeks -- that happens, especially with surgical varieties of masks -- and under the chin. You can do things to make your mask fit higher, corresponding to tightening up the ear loop.”


For these using surgical masks, Marr recommends the CDC’s knot-and-tuck (opens in new tab) technique for making a tighter seal. Facial hair will interfere with the seal, so Marr advises a mustache or goatee that matches inside the mask. “If you do have a variety of facial hair, and you want to maintain it, I feel something like a surgical mask with a neck gaiter to hold it tightly against your face can assist,” she says.


4. Consider One-Approach Masking In Excessive-Danger Situations


Marr says educators should want to put on masks in sure conditions. “If local circumstances were high and the vaccination rates in my area have been low, that might tip me more towards masking,” she says. “If we go to a really crowded room with lots of people for an assembly or something like that where individuals are sitting close collectively and the air is stuffy, that could be a time where one-manner masking can be more necessary.”


5. Even when You’re Not One-Way Masking, Don’t Throw Away Your Mask Just But


Even those who are not one-means masking ought to keep their masks useful for the long run. “Mask mandates are being lifted, which I think makes sense as instances come down,” Marr says, but she advises holding onto these masks. “I hope that masking tradition in this country has changed and that we are more open to contemplating it. I believe there may be occasions sooner or later when it can be helpful to have mask mandates again for brief periods of time throughout surges.”


Unfortunately, nuance usually gets misplaced in the politicized and highly polarized battle over masks and mask mandates. “I see this argument of ‘masks work’ versus ‘masks do not work.’ And each are right and each are fallacious because it is not zero or one hundred p.c,” Marr says. “Masks assist, they reduce your exposure, and a few masks are better than others.”
